In 2020-2021, 3,131 people earned their degree in food and nutrition, making the major the 228th most popular in the United States.
Across Mississippi, there were 25 food and nutrition gra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.
This year’s “Schools Highly Focused on Food & Nutrition Major in Mississippi” ranking analyzed 4 colleges that offered a degree in food and nutrition. This a ranking of the schools where the largest percentage of students has enrolled in food and nutrition.
